Eden Prairie CPR class to benefit healthcare professionals

Next month, In-Pulse CPR in conjunction with the American Heart Association will host the CPR Heart Code Skills for E-learning Class in Eden Prairie for healthcare professionals needing c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) training.

Founded in 2009 by nurse Mollie Bowman, In-Pulse CPR is Minneapolis’ largest American Heart training provider. Mollie created the organization after becoming frustrated with the standard of CPR training courses she encountered in her own professional life. In-Pulse CPR provides students with dynamic, hands-on certification courses that are engaging and taught by experienced health professionals.

The CPR Heart Code Skills is designed for physicians, nurses, nursing students, hygienists, emergency medical personnel, dental students, pharmacists, and any other healthcare provider that requires CPR certification. This interactive class can only be taken after individuals have taken the online HeartCode® BLS course and have shown their American Heart Association Certificate of Completion to the class instructor.
